ONE FOX


One fox, nose to the ground. Searching? Yes.

But not for a scent; searching for a trail of magic.

.

Two foxes meet in a park, confer. Did he go that way? No. That way.

.

Nine foxes converge beneath a window. Their quarry is inside, but not alone. Why must humans have so many emotions? It muddles the trail.

Eight foxes skulk away, one keeps watch.

.

Their quarry trails magic behind him; they’d like to learn his powers. But he always runs.

.

One fox pauses at a bus stop. A human points. The trail is strong now.

One fox goes on.

Po was at the docks, already smirking, when at last they disembarked in Monport.

“Oh, shut up,” Giddon told him, but it was hard to keep from grinning. He was fairly sure he’d been grinning since the moment he’d woken from his faint and found Bitterblue still alive.

Po embraced Bitterblue, then Giddon. Arm still slung around Giddon, he tousled Bitterblue’s wind-tossed hair, making her yelp. “You two finally figured it out, then?” Po asked, as Bitterblue shoved him away, then pulled him back to hug again.

“Yes,” Bitterblue said. “Now, you hush.”

Po only beamed at both of them.
